Global Hospital Supplies Market size was valued at USD 48.71 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 54.8 Billion in 2025 to USD 140.61 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 12.5%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
The Global Hospital Supplies Market is propelled by a growing demand for healthcare services, fueled by population growth, an aging population, and the rising incidence of chronic illnesses, leading to heightened patient volumes in medical facilities. This surge necessitates hospitals to ensure an abundant supply of critical items such as surgical instruments, disposable consumables, personal protective equipment, and diagnostic tools to maintain continuous patient care and operational efficiency. Additionally, technological advancements significantly impact this market, as hospitals increasingly integrate innovative medical devices like automated surgical instruments and smart diagnostic systems to enhance precision, safety, and efficiency in medical procedures. Consequently, the push for modernization influences purchasing behavior, driving both demand and sophistication within the hospital supplies sector.

Driver of the Global Hospital Supplies Market
One of the key market drivers for the Global Hospital Supplies Market is the increasing demand for advanced healthcare services due to a rising global population and a growing prevalence of chronic diseases. As healthcare organizations strive to enhance patient outcomes and adopt more efficient practices, the need for high-quality hospital supplies, including surgical instruments, disposable items, and diagnostic tools, becomes paramount. This demand is further fueled by the emphasis on infection control and safety protocols, compelling hospitals to invest in innovative products and technologies that ensure sterility and reduce the risk of hospital-acquired infections, thereby propelling market growth significantly.
Restraints in the Global Hospital Supplies Market
One significant market restraint for the global hospital supplies market is the increasing pressure on healthcare budgets and cost containment measures. Hospitals and healthcare facilities are continually seeking to reduce operational expenses, leading to tighter procurement processes and increased scrutiny on supply costs. This focus on cost efficiency often prioritizes lower-priced alternatives over quality, which could affect the reliability and performance of hospital supplies. Moreover, stringent regulations and compliance requirements can further complicate supply chain operations, making it challenging for manufacturers to balance quality, safety, and affordability while meeting the evolving needs of healthcare providers.
Market Trends of the Global Hospital Supplies Market
The expansion of ambulatory surgical centers (ASCs) is significantly shaping the global hospital supplies market, creating a robust demand for specialized, cost-effective, and efficient medical equipment tailored for outpatient procedures. ASCs prioritize compact solutions that streamline operations and enhance patient care, leading to increased adoption of modular kits, advanced wound care products, and portable diagnostic tools. This shift not only fosters innovation in medical supply design and production but also drives manufacturers to cater to the unique requirements of ASCs. Consequently, this trend is contributing to a notable growth trajectory in the global hospital supplies market, reflecting a transformational shift in healthcare delivery.
